Description

There are dozens of faery types: nymphs, elves, dwarves, pixies, leprechauns and flower faeries, to name a few. Every culture on Earth shares a traditional belief in the 'Little People'. The Book of Faeries describes more than 50 types of faery from all over the world, explaining their folklore, characteristics and attributes. From mischievous pranksters such as Puck and Gremlins to the angelic faeries, who have much in common with guardian angels, The Book of Faeries reveals how the world of nature spirits and faery beings can bring wisdom, joy, and success. With special rituals, spells and recipes, along with the faeries favourite plants for healing, divination and spiritual growth, this book reveals a magical side of life that has almost been forgotten in the today's world. Beautifully illustrated this is an enchanting and fascinating guide to the history of faeries, how these beings participate at all levels of life and how they can be engaged to re-enchant modern lives.
